So after getting the motor dialed in I scooted over to crappie cove to throw a jig in my little honey hole at around 6PM. I was expecting bass as I was throwing a 5" white lunker grub on a 3/8oz jig head. Third cast I nailed this guy.


Pretty healthy little crappie
I started getting nailed cast after cast but my jig was too big for this tiny mouthed fish. Switched over to a white panfish assassin and started rippin some lips.



I could definitely tell the minnows were being worked by these guys. From time to time a few minnows would break surface and at one point I saw a mini whirlpool in the water which I assume was the crappy working the minnows in a circle at the surface.
I think I cuaght seven all together with a few coming off at the side of the boat. All fish were released healthily to fight another day.
